Abstract :
Higher Harmonic Control (HHC) is a method for cancelling the helicopter fuselage vibrations by introducing N/rev oscillations of rotor blades pitch angle (N is the number of rotor blades). This method is effective if both the amplitude and the phase of the oscillations introduced are chosen appropriately, depending on the flight conditions. It is shown in this paper that if the frequency of these oscillations is much greater than N/rev, the phase dependency disappears.
